In 1492, Catherine Brereton entered the world in Brereton cum Smethwick, Cheshire, England, born to Andrew de Brereton Brereton and Agnes Margaret Leigh. Catherine Brereton married Thomas Smith, Thomas Assheton Hough Smith, and had children including Margret Smith. Catherine Brereton passed away in 1541 in Gawsworth, Cheshire, England.
